Is Honda an American made car?

Made in the USA

Honda began manufacturing in America in 1979 when it opened its first plant in Marysville, Ohio. Today, Honda builds products at 12 manufacturing plants across the country. Honda has built 26.1 million cars and light trucks in the U.S. since 1982.

Where are Hondas made?

Honda vehicles are created in state-of-the-art manufacturing plants located in Japan, Mexico, and the United States. The United States plays a big role in Honda manufacturing with a great deal of model parts sourced within the country, primarily from the Midwestern and Southern regions.

WHO country makes Honda?

Honda: Made in What Country? Although Honda was founded in 1948 in Hamamatsu, Shizuoka, Japan, production has shifted increasingly to North America when it comes to Honda vehicles that are sold in the U.S. Honda expanded U.S. production in 2016 with a new manufacturing plant, upping the count to 12.

Is Honda a good car?

Honda has won many awards which attests to its quality. This company has won the Car and Driver Top Manufacturer Awards more time than any other brand has. They've received this award about 80 times, which is two times more than Toyota has with 38. The Honda Accord alone won that award 27 times.

Why are Hondas so expensive?

Hondas are expensive because of a worsening inventory shortage at dealers across the country. A lack of semiconductor chips has resulted in major production problems from most car brands. In the case of Honda, consumers may find their favorite vehicle to be considerably more expensive compared to normal prices.

Why is Honda reliability decline?

According to Consumer Reports, Honda's reliability dropped because of its new and redesigned models. CR says, “The Odyssey minivan had much-worse-than-average reliability, with problems including the infotainment system, and door locking and unlocking.

Who owns Toyota?

Toyota Motor Corporation, Japanese Toyota Jidōsha KK, Japanese parent company of the Toyota Group. It became the largest automobile manufacturer in the world for the first time in 2008, surpassing General Motors.
